Who Is Derek Mathewson?

Derek Mathewson is best understood as a working motor trade expert who later became a familiar television figure. His public identity did not come from acting, influencer marketing, or celebrity branding. It came from decades of buying, selling, valuing, and auctioning vehicles. That is why his image feels different from many TV personalities. He looks and sounds like someone who has spent real time around garages, paperwork, sellers, bidders, and old engines.

The official Mathewsons history states that the business began in 1970 with modern cars and commercial vehicles in Bedfordshire. Even in those early years, Derek Mathewson’s passion for vintage and classic cars remained central to the showrooms. Early Life and Entry Into the Motor Trade

Public information about Derek Mathewson’s childhood stays limited, which fits his private personality. He did not build fame around personal drama or a carefully designed celebrity origin story. Most trustworthy accounts focus on his professional life because that is where his public value sits. The stronger biography angle is not “gossip about Derek,” but “how a long motor trade career became a public-facing classic car brand.”

His entry into the car world began with ordinary commercial experience. Classic & Sports Car described him as a car trader since 1970 and noted that he first worked as an auction customer, buying contemporary stock at used-car trade sales before retailing vehicles himself. That detail matters because it explains his practical judgment. He learned the market from the buyer’s side before becoming known as an auctioneer and television personality.

The Growth of Mathewsons

Mathewsons grew from a motor trade business into a known classic vehicle auction name. The company first served retail and trade customers, then branched into vehicle contract hire and leasing across the UK. Later, family links and repeated holidays in the north helped shape the move to North Yorkshire. The official company history records the purchase of a Scarborough garage in 1988, followed by Malton in 1990 and Pickering in 1992.

Moving Into Classic Car Auctions

The Mathewsons business did not become famous overnight. During the 1990s, the company worked mainly with modern dealership activity, including Kia and Skoda franchises. Over time, the classic and vintage side became the main focus. In 2011, Mathewsons entered the world of classic car auctions at its Thornton-le-Dale museum and showroom premises.

That shift changed the business identity. A normal used-car business sells transport. A classic vehicle auction sells transport, history, memory, and emotion. Derek Mathewson understood that a car’s value can come from rarity, condition, restoration quality, originality, mileage, old paperwork, family ownership, and nostalgia. This is the psychology behind classic car buying: people often bid with memory as much as money.

Derek Mathewson and Bangers & Cash

Derek Mathewson became widely known through Bangers & Cash, the documentary series that follows the Mathewsons family as they search for classic vehicles, uncover ownership stories, and sell cars through auction. Prime Video describes the show around a North Yorkshire dynasty of classic car auctioneers who hunt for rare vehicles and reveal stories behind classic car ownership. The listed cast includes Derek Mathewson, Dave Mathewson, and Paul Mathewson.

The show works because it uses a simple but powerful content strategy. It combines family business, rural North Yorkshire charm, vintage motoring culture, auction tension, and human stories. Viewers do not only watch for prices. They watch because old cars connect to parents, childhood, first jobs, weekend drives, and lost local history. That emotional layer makes Derek Mathewson more than a car dealer on screen. He becomes a guide through memory.

Mathewsons as a Family Brand

The Mathewsons name is not only about Derek. It is also about family continuity. Dave Mathewson and Paul Mathewson appear in the Bangers & Cash world and remain closely tied to the business identity. Companies House records for Mathewsons Classic Cars Ltd list David Terrence Mathewson and Paul Craig Mathewson as active directors, which supports the public view of Mathewsons as a continuing family enterprise.

This family structure strengthens the brand. Viewers see different generations working around the same business, and that creates a more personal connection. Derek Mathewson’s Cars and Personal Taste

Derek Mathewson is strongly linked with classic cars not only as a business category but also as a personal passion. Classic & Sports Car reported that his personal collection is closely connected with the company setting and noted his interest in Aston Martins, including a DB6. The same feature explained that he bought a damaged DB6 in the late 1980s, repaired it, and used it as a regular car before values rose sharply.

His taste appears broader than high-value prestige cars alone. That is part of his appeal. In the Bangers & Cash world, a modest family saloon, old van, motorbike, or commercial vehicle can matter as much as a luxury classic if it carries history and character. This is why his image connects with ordinary viewers. He helps make classic motoring feel accessible instead of locked behind elite collector culture.

Current Business Status

Mathewsons Auctions Ltd is listed as an active private limited company by Companies House, with business activity connected to the sale of used cars and other motor vehicles. This supports the view that the Mathewsons auction operation remains an active business entity rather than only a television backdrop.

That point is important because Bangers & Cash can make the auction house feel like entertainment, but buyers and sellers deal with a real business. The cars, valuations, fees, bidding, and risks remain practical matters. Derek Mathewson’s strength is that he represents both sides: television-friendly storytelling and serious motor trade experience.
